ABSTRACT
Polyurethane non woven membranes with microporous inner layer and macroporous outer layer where tested bacteriologically and histologically. It was proved that the macroporous layer is suitable for the ingrowth and maturing of connective tissue, while the microporous structure prevents the invasion of bacteria, nevertheless being permeable for nutrient substances. So the material could be yield favourable presupposition to achieve bioincorporation in contaminated borderlines.
